It is with profound sadness that we announce the peaceful passing of our loving mother and grandmother, Miriam Florence Aquanno on Wednesday January 25th, 2023. Reunited with her partner in love and in life, Frank Aquanno. Born in the little village of South Petherton, Somerset, England on the 4th of November 1928, to William and Nora Keetch. Mom was the eldest of 4 siblings; Molly, Philip (deceased infant) and Phillippa (deceased). A year after she met Frank in England, she left home to join him in Canada in 1948 where she made it her home and spent the next 66 years with her Honey. Loving mother to Mike (Julie), Chris (Deb) and Tom (Kim). Dedicated nanny to Scott (Kim), Amber (Tyler), Kristen (Stu), Josh (Mel), Caroline and Connor. Dearly missed by her 10 great-grandchildren; Alexa, Jackson, Kaitlynn, Charlie, Megan, Tiffany, Liam, Lillianna, Madison and Nathan. Fondly remembered by her loving sister, Molly and her sister-in-law, Lee. Preceded by her baby sister, Phillippa and brothers-in-law Dave, Tony King and Tony Aquanno. She will be fondly remembered by her many nieces, nephews, cousins and friends. Mom can now renew close friendships, evening the players around the Mahjong table. Forever in our hearts, we will miss you dearly. We love you mom.
